All Around the Moon by Jules Verne: A sequel to From the Earth to the Moon, this novel continues the story of the first lunar expedition as it navigates the dangers and mysteries of the moon's surface. With its blend of science, adventure, and romance, this book is a classic of the science fiction genre.Key Aspects of the Book "All Around the Moon":
Sequel: Verne's novel follows up on the storyline established in From the Earth to the Moon, providing a thrilling continuation of the original story.
Science and Technology: The book explores cutting-edge scientific and technological concepts, from space travel to lunar geology, inspiring generations of readers to imagine new possibilities.
Human Relationships: The novel also touches on themes of love, friendship, and loyalty, making for a multi-layered and emotionally engaging story.Jules Verne was a French novelist and playwright known for his pioneering works of science fiction and adventure. Born in 1828, he was one of the most popular and influential authors of the 19th century, inspiring generations of writers to imagine new worlds and push the boundaries of scientific discovery.
